数据库和实例的概念

数据库

数据库是磁盘上数据的集合,位于数据库服务器上的一个或者多个文件中。

组成数据库文件主要分为两类:

数据库文件   :存储数据和元数据                    --非常重要

非数据库文件:初始参数文件和日志记录文件

实例

服务器的部分:一个或者多个CPU,磁盘空间和内存。

数据库存储在服务器的磁盘上,而实例存在于服务器和内存。

实例由一个大型内存块和大量后台进程组成的

内存:      系统全局区(System Global Area)

后台进程:后台进程在SGA和磁盘上的数据库文件交互

Oracle RAC ,多个实例将使用同一个数据库。大多数实例位于不同的服务器上,这些服务器通过高速互连进行连接,并且访问驻留在专门的,支持RAID的磁盘子系统上的数据库。

时间: 2024-08-20 17:39:31

数据库和实例的概念的相关文章

数据库的本质、概念及其应用实践

今天这堂课,分为三个大点,正如标题所指出的,是讨论数据的本质.概念与应用实践.第一点本质的探讨是站在一个更高的高度来分析数据的产生以及各种使用场景,然后将数据相关的存储手段,作一个汇总讲解.而概念,则是一个串讲,主要放在关系数据库上,因为我们六月份公开课,也将以关系型数据库为主.第三点就是通过一些实例来巩固前面两点所讲的内容. 一.数据库的出现源起和本质 1.1 数据库的起源 想像一下我们的电脑,有目录,有文件,文件有大小,有位置,有格式,这个是有文件系统开始就有这个概念的,肯定在有一个地方,存

[转] Oracle学习之创建数据库(新建实例)

由于项目需求,在本机中开发,需要新建oracle数据库实例,亲测可以. 出处:http://blog.csdn.NET/luiseradl/article/details/6972217 http://wenku.baidu.com/view/864b9b2c453610661ed9f469.html My points: (1)我的头头说一般不需要创建数据库,在Orcl数据库中创建用户,创建用户对应的表就成了: (2)删除数据库和创建数据库启动的软件是一个. 一.新建实例1.安装好Oracle

数据库和实例

作为一个菜鸟(指本人)以前跟别人讨论数据库时经常会说:"Oracle数据库.SQL Server数据库.DB2数据库",以至于我认为数据库是一种软件(对于Oracle.微软.IBM来说也确实是软件),刚接触Oracle时才知道一个完整的"数据库"需要有数据库和实例.这是很多初学者比较难以掌握的概念. 那这两者到底是什么? 数据库(database):物理操作系统文件或磁盘(disk)的集合.使用Oracle 10g 的自动存储管理(Automatic Storage

oracle 数据库、实例、服务名、SID

参考:http://www.zhetao.com/content240 在实际的开发应用中,关于Oracle数据库,经常听见有人说建立一个数据库,建立一个Instance,启动一个Instance之类的话. 其实问他们什么是数据库,什么是Instance,很可能他们给的答案就是数据库就是Instance,Instance就是数据库啊,没有什么区别. 在这里,只能说虽然他们Oracle用了可能有了一定的经验,不过基础的概念还是不太清楚.(我目前就是这个状态) 一.什么是数据库,其实很简单,数据库就

创建WRAPPER时, SQL20076N 未对指定的操作启用数据库的实例。

您可以通过运行DB2 UPDATE DBM CFG USING FEDERATED YES来设置这个参数.修改这个参数后,必须重新启动实例才会生效(DB2STOP/DB2START).所以你会出现你的 那个错误: 未启动实例 本文说明的是在同一个数据库实例中,在源数据库dbsrc中访问目标库dbtarget的表table1的方法 用户名:usr,密码:pwd db2 版本: UDB FOR AIX 8.2.2 OS: Microsoft Windows XP Professional versi

区分Oracle的数据库,实例,服务名,SID

文章摘自:http://www.zhetao.com/content240 感谢分享O(∩_∩)O~ 在实际的开发应用中,关于Oracle数据库,经常听见有人说建立一个数据库,建立一个Instance,启动一个Instance之类的话.其实问他们什么是数据库,什么是Instance,很可能他们给的答案就是数据库就是Instance,Instance就是数据库啊,没有什么区别.在这里,只能说虽然他们Oracle用了可能有了一定的经验,不过基础的概念还是不太清楚. 什么是数据库,其实很简单,数据库就

ORACLE 数据库、实例、表空间、用户、数据库对象

Oracle是一种数据库管理系统,是一种关系型的数据库管理系统.通常情况了我们称的"数据库",包含了物理数据.数据库管理系统.内存.操作系统进程的组合体,就是指这里所说的数据库管理系统. 完整的Oracle数据库通常由两部分组成:Oracle数据库和数据库实例. ① Oracle数据库是一系列物理文件的集合: 组成Oracle数据库的文件可以分成三个类型:数据文件(data file).重做日志文件(redo log file)和控制文件(control file).数据文件保存数据,

MySQL数据库多实例主从同步

本文主要介绍单台服务器MySQL数据库多实例的主从同步,一般常规做主从复制主从服务器在不同的机器上,并且监听端口均为默认的3306端口.一.环境介绍 操作系统:CentOS 6.5 数据库版本:MySQL 5.5.32 主库主机名称:mysql-master(172.18.10.222:3306) 从库主机名称:mysql-slave(172.18.10.222:3307) 二.主从同步原理介绍  简单描述主从复制原理: 1.在Slave服务器命令行执行start slave,开启主从复制开关

数据库中一些基本概念的深入理解

1.怎样理解事务的一致性 一致性就是一个这样的东西,一致性对于不同的应用领域有着不同的定义,因为它就是按照业务规则来说明这个是一致的,那个是不一致的,这个角度上讲,一致性就是一个系统的状态,一个合理的状态.而合理则表现在这个状态是否符合业务规则.例如:转账业务中合理的状态就是,转出和转入帐户必须出入相等,如果不等那就意味着不合理,也就是不一致,有时候我们很容易就能把它定为"守恒一致性",也就是说总体来说什么也不多,什么也不少就是一致性.而这个规则能够使用于其他的义务吗?我们不能说不能,